Transaction e61788daaddb0679d9f9a95e1dad8a87481dcf29a8ce1d1e856db47daff98fbd
1 Input
2 Outputs
- e61788daaddb0679d9f9a95e1dad8a87481dcf29a8ce1d1e856db47daff98fbd:0
- e61788daaddb0679d9f9a95e1dad8a87481dcf29a8ce1d1e856db47daff98fbd:1
value 19254866
address 1KGTfs84iFXctCipFcGH22dVPA2gKcBE9i
value 130730670
address 3HTNEDT6MGCYsJA8p53vDBxDmKAFgP3C32